- The distance between Wiluna, Western Australia, Australia and San Angelo, Texas, Usa is approximately 16,039 km or 9,967 mi.
- To reach Wiluna, Western Australia in this distance one would set out from San Angelo, Texas bearing 267.1°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Wiluna, Western Australia bearing 252.5° or WSW .
- Wiluna, Western Australia has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as San Angelo, Texas has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Wiluna, Western Australia is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ome whereas San Angelo, Texas is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 3.3 °C (6°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.2 °C (5.8°F) less in Wiluna, Western Australia.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 285.4 mm (11.2 in) less which is equivalent to 285.4 l/m² (7 US gal/ft²) or 2,854,000 l/ha (305,112 US gal/ac) less. About 4/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4° higher in Wiluna, Western Australia than in San Angelo, Texas.
- Relative humidity levels are 18.8%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 5°C (9.1°F) lower.
